Publisher's summary

Clockwork gunslingers. Chinese assassins. A world of magic. The Blood War Chronicles.

When assassins jump half-clockwork gunslinger Jake Lasater, he knows the Chinese Tong wants to finally settle an old score. Unfortunately, Jake has no idea the Tong is just the first milepost on the road toward a destiny he refuses to believe in. With his riding partner, Cole McJunkins, in tow and his ward, Skeeter, secretly hidden away, Jake squares off against a deadly clockwork mercenary from his past and a troop of crazed European soldiers who want him dead. Add an insane emperor with knowledge of Jake’s past and a mysterious noblewoman who desperately needs his help - and Jake is faced with a whole mess of trouble, with no end in sight.

Blood Ties launches an epic saga that spans worlds and threatens the human race itself.

Steampunk Fantasy

A fun adventure full of Steampunk and fantasy, magic trickling all around, and two gunslingers fresh out of the civil war. I notice a lot of steampunk seems to take place near the Civil War, and it always makes for an interesting read. The two main characters were developed nicely. They each had their own struggles and backstory that fit well with the plot. The plot got a bit messy from time to time, with the main characters never really knowing what was going on. It kept a puzzle in your head to try and figure it all out. The narrator did a good job with this one, and this book paints a good picture for book 1 in a series. I'm looking forward to checking out the rest!
